South Korea Artificial Heart Valve Market Overview

The South Korea artificial heart valve market has experienced significant growth in recent years, driven by an aging population and increasing prevalence of cardiovascular diseases. As of 2023, the market size is estimated at approximately USD 350 million, with projections indicating a robust compound annual growth rate (CAGR) of around 8.2% over the forecast period from 2023 to 2030. By 2030, the market is expected to surpass USD 700 million, reflecting heightened demand for advanced valve replacement solutions and minimally invasive procedures. The rapid adoption of innovative technologies and expanding healthcare infrastructure are key factors underpinning this growth trajectory, positioning South Korea as a prominent player in the Asia-Pacific region’s cardiovascular device landscape.
